Description

Dave Smith commented: "The Prophet X is a powerful evolution of the Prophet series. Musicians have been asking for samples through real analog flters for a long time. We've given them not only that, but also all of the synthesis capabilites and awesome sound you'd expect from a Prophet."

For sample content, Dave Smith turned to acclaimed sound developers 8Dio, known for pioneering "deep sampling," a detailed approach to sampling that aims to capture all of the nuances and idiosyncracies of a particular sound or instrument. 8Dio co-founder Troels Folmann put it this way: "We're known for going anywhere and everywhere with sounds. We embrace all sounds as music and feel that if you can capture the musical soul of a sound, you can
make it into an instrument. The Prophet X gives musicians a very immediate and responsive way to access this expressiveness."

The 150 GB sample library in the Prophet X includes numerous acoustic and electronic instruments as well as an extensive collection of ambient and cinematic effects. Users can shape the samples through loop manipulation, sample stretching, and the synthesizer's many sound-sculpting functions which include 4 envelope generators, 4 LFOs, a deep modulation matrix, and other tools. The Prophet X also provides 50 gigabytes of internal storage for importing additional samples. Several sample libraries will be available from 8Dio at launch. Support for user-created sample content is planned for December, 2018.

A dual-effects engine provides multiple reverbs, two delays (standard and BBD), a chorus, flanger, phase shifter, rotating speaker, high-pass filter, and distortion. In stacked or split voice mode, you can apply two different effects to each layer. Effects parameters can be modulated through the mod matrix as can the samples themselves. A polyphonic step sequencer allows up to 64 steps and up to 6 notes per step, per layer. The Prophet X features a premium-quality,
five-octave, semi-weighted keyboard with velocity and channel aftertouch, an integrated power supply, USB support, and three OLED displays.

Dave Smith summed up the new instrument: "Composers will love the Prophet X for soundtracks and synth geeks will love it for its sound mangling potential. But it's really for everyone because it covers such a wide range of sounds. The new analog filter design we're using is not only fantastic for synth sounds, but also does something special for the samples." Added 8Dio co-founder Tawnia Knox: "The Prophet X has almost infinite posibilites. But more importantly, it has a soul. It's alive. You can touch your sounds in a different way than you ever could."


About 8Dio
Founded in 2011 by Troels Folmann and Tawnia Knox, 8Dio is the leading independent developer of software instruments and the inventors of deep-sampling. Troels is an Academy Award, TEC/Mix Foundation, GANG and D3 award-winning composer and Ph.D scholar in music technologies. Tawnia is the CEO of 8Dio Productions and has had a long career as an executive in luxury brands. 8Dio has created an extensive, deep-sampled catalog of advanced instruments based on literally millions of samples. Notable titles include Majestica - the largest symphony orchestra ever sampled, Epic Taiko Ensembles, Titanic Choirs, Cinematic Scoring Tools, and over 250 other instruments. 8Dio products are used by high-profile artists, composers, and top music producers in all genres. They are featured in a majority of current blockbuster movies, independent films, video games, TV-shows, Broadway productions, and the professional sports industry.

News: 2020 February: Version 2.2 OS

Prophet X Boasts New OS and Robust Third-Party Support


San Francisco, CA—Feb 13, 2020—Sequential today announced several developments that have enhanced their flagship hybrid samples+synthesis keyboard, the Prophet X. These include a new OS, two full-featured third-party sample editing applications, and several add-on sample libraries from 8Dio and other sound developers.


The new 2.2 OS adds several user-requested features including 24 additional User Sample Groups, support for crossfades on forward-backward loops, and the capability to modulate between tempo-synced LFO values. The new features build on an already-powerful foundation of sound shaping tools and the fusion of samples and synthesis. The new OS is designed for both the Prophet X and Prophet XL and can be downloaded from the Prophet X/ XL support page on Sequential’s website.


Another significant development for the synthesizer, which supports up to 50 GB of user-created sample content, is the availability of two powerful third-party sample creation/editing tools. The first, PXToolkit, is a free application from developer ThinkerSnacks which offers drag and drop file creation with automatic extraction of pitch and loop metadata from .WAV files, as well as support for multi-sampled instruments, multiple velocity layers per key, and round-robin sample selection and playback. The software can be downloaded free of charge from the ThinkerSnack website.


The second tool, SAMPLEROBOT Pro 6.5 from Skylife, brings Prophet X support to their popular and highly-acclaimed auto-sampling and sample editing application. It supports multi-sampled instruments, multiple velocity layers per key and powerful looping and editing tools. The software is available for purchase from Skylife’s website.


Also noteworthy is the abundance of third-party add-on sample packs that can be imported into the Prophet X and manipulated as part of its hybid sound engine. The most prolific among the various sound developers creating content for the synthesizer is 8Dio, with eight Prophet X-specific products to date. These include deep-sampled versions of vintage instruments such as the Yamaha CP70, ARP 2600, Oberheim OB-X, Sequential Prophet-5 and T-8, Roland Jupiter 4, and Moog Prodigy and Minimoog Model D synths.


Add-On packs from other developers include:

- Replicants from Modulatable Synthesis (samples of the Deckard’s Dream poly synth)

- The 9000 Foot Piano from Pianobook (samples of a renowned Yamaha grand piano)

- BlueWave from Goldbaby (samples of the PPG Wave 2.2)

- VCO Pack from ThinkerSnacks VCO samples from the Neutron, OB-6, Dreadbox Erebus, and Moog Voyager)


“We’re excited about the support that the Prophet X is getting from third-party developers. Clearly they feel, as we do, that it’s a hugely powerful synth with incredible potential,” commented Dave Smith. “Having access to these new editing tools and add-on sample packs makes an already-awesome musical tool even more versatile. ”


The Prophet X has garnered critical acclaim for its sonic versatility and sound design capabilities through its substantial internal library of 150 GB of sample content as well as its ability to import up to 50 GB of additional user samples and add-on content from sound developers.


All sample content can be manipulated by the Prophet X sound engine, which powers two simultaneous sample-based instruments plus two high-resolution digital oscillators, with a full complement of traditional synthesis tools, all processed through analog filters. Dual digital effects and a 64-step polyphonic sequencer round out the package. In standard performance mode, the instrument provides bi-timbral, 8-voice stereo, or 16-voice mono operation. Thirty-two-voice performance mode allows paraphonic filter operation when using a single sampled instrument and oscillator.

Properties

- Sample Playback
2 multi-sampled stereo instruments per voice with editable sample start, sample end, loop size, and loop center, loop on/off, sample reverse, sample stretch, bit-rate reduction, and sample rate reduction
- 150 GB of factory-installed 16-bit, 48 kHz sampled instruments created by 8Dio. An additional 50 GB of samples can be added by purchasing additional sound libraries. User-sample import is planned for December, 2018.
- Oscillators
2 digital oscillators per voice with selectable sine, sawtooth, pulse, and supersaw waves. You can vary the shape of any of the waveshapes.
- Glide (portamento): separate rates per oscillator; (samples can glide in Sample Stretch mode)
- Hard sync
- Filters
2 x analog 4-pole resonant low-pass filter per voice
- Digital high-pass filter in Effects section
- Envelopes
- 4 loopable, five-stage (ADSR plus delay) envelope generators: Filter, VCA, and two assignable
- Sequencer
- Polyphonic step sequencer with up to 64 steps (6 notes per step), and ties and rests.
- AMPLIFIER ENVELOPE
Four-stage (ADSR) envelope generator
- Velocity modulation of envelope amount
- LOW FREQUENCY OSCILLATORS
4 LFO's with key sync, phase offset, and slewing per LFO
- Five wave shapes: triangle, sawtooth, reverse sawtooth, square, and random (sample and hold)
- Modulation
16-slot modulation matrix
- 28 sources
- 88 destinations
- 11 additional dedicated sources: mod wheel, pressure, velocity, breath controller, footswitch, LFO 1, LFO 2, LFO 3, LFO 4, Env 3, Env 4
- ARPEGGIATOR
Fully-featured arpeggiator with up, down, up+down, random, assign modes
- Selectable note value: 16th note, 8th note triplet, 8th note, dotted 8th note, quarter note
- One, two, or three octave range
- Re-latching arpeggiation
- Note repeat
- DIGITAL EFFECTS
2 digital effects on each layer
- Stereo delay, BBD delay, chorus, flanger, phaser, vintage rotating speaker, distortion, high-pass filter, spring reverb, room reverb, hall reverb, super plate reverb
- CLOCK
Master clock with tap tempo
- BPM control and display
- MIDI clock sync
- PERFORMANCE CONTROLS
Full-sized, semi-weighted, 5-octave keyboard with velocity and channel (mono) aftertouch
- Backlit pitch and mod wheels
- Spring-loaded pitch wheel with selectable range per program (1 to 12 semitones up and down)
- Transpose controls for an 8-octave range
- Hold switch latches held notes on
- Polyphonic glide (portamento)
- Unison (monophonic) mode with configurable voice count
- PATCH MEMORY
- 512 Factory Programs (4 banks of 128) and 512 fully editable User Programs with 2 layers (2 separate sounds) in each Program
- IN/OUT
MIDI In, Out, Thru
- USB MIDI
- Sample import jack for USB Stick
- Main stereo audio output: 2 x 1/4" phone (TS, unbalanced)
- Output B stereo audio output: 2 x 1/4" phone (TS, unbalanced)
- Pedal/CV: responds to expression pedals or control voltages ranging from 0 to 5 VDC (protected against higher or negative voltages.
- Volume: responds to expression pedals or control voltages ranging from 0 to 5 VDC (protected against higher or negative voltages.
- Sustain pedal input: accepts normally on or normally off momentary footswitch.
- Sequencer: accepts normally on or normally off momentary footswitch to trigger sequencer playback.
- Headphone output: 1/4" stereo phone jack.
- POWER
IEC AC power inlet for internal power supply
- Operates worldwide on voltages between 100 and 240 volts at 50 to 60 Hz
- Power consumption: 25 watts maximum

Brand

Sequential is led by legendary instrument designer and Grammy-winner Dave Smith, the founder of Sequential Circuits in 1974. In 1977 Dave designed the Prophet-5, the world’s first fully-programmable polyphonic synth, and the first musical instrument with an embedded microprocessor. Sequential released many innovative instruments and drum machines over the next 10 years. Dave is known as the driving force behind the MIDI specification in 1981. It was Dave, in fact, who coined the acronym. In 1987 he was named a Fellow of the Audio Engineering Society (AES) for his continuing work in the area of music synthesis. After Sequential, Dave was President of DSD, Inc, an R&D division of Yamaha, where he worked on physical modeling synthesis and software synthesizer concepts. He then started the Korg R&D group in California, producing the Wavestation and other technology. He took over as President at Seer Systems and developed the first soft synth for Intel in 1994, followed by the first professional soft synth, Reality, released in 1997. Realizing the limitations of software, Dave returned to hardware and started Dave Smith Instruments, starting with the Evolver hybrid analog/digital synthesizer in 2002. The product lineup has grown to include the Prophet X, Prophet Rev2, Prophet-6, OB-6 (with Tom Oberheim), Pro 2, and Prophet 12 synthesizers, and the Tempest drum machine (with Roger Linn). In 2018 DSI changed its name to Sequential, bringing Dave’s legacy full-circle.
